What does the word "Cofermentation" mean?

Cofermentation is a fascinating term that finds its roots in the domains of microbiology and fermentation science. It refers to the simultaneous fermentation of two or more substrates by various microorganisms, including bacteria, yeast, and fungi. This process is particularly significant in the production of various beverages, food products, and biofuels, where the complex interplay of microbes leads to novel flavors, enhanced nutritional profiles, and improved efficiency in production.

At its core, cofermentation takes advantage of the diverse metabolic capabilities of different microorganisms to maximize the conversion of raw materials into desired end products. For example, using a combination of yeast and lactic acid bacteria can enhance the flavor and texture of fermented foods like yogurt or sourdough bread.

In recent years, cofermentation has gained traction in the field of environmental science, particularly in the context of waste treatment and bioremediation. Mixed cultures of microbes can break down organic waste more efficiently, leading to the production of biogas or other useful compounds. Below are some key aspects and benefits of cofermentation:

Despite its benefits, cofermentation also presents challenges. The interaction between different microorganisms can result in competition for resources or even the inhibition of one another’s growth. Successful cofermentation often requires careful balancing of conditions such as pH, temperature, and nutrient availability to achieve optimal results.
